IP查询
查询
你查询的IP:[118.224.36.222] 地理位置:中国–北京–北京
最新查询
120.137.3.186
114.68.48.246
123.98.254.19
121.201.126.159
221.136.87.37
210.78.119.119
119.9.47.96
202.70.109.178
120.76.122.88
118.224.36.222
123.8.102.117
202.38.149.106
114.80.115.230
120.32.86.131
203.100.192.153
203.176.168.157
117.21.27.214
121.51.155.43
124.29.130.155
219.216.153.184
202.149.224.151
202.60.112.100
60.245.128.74
116.58.208.193
121.59.64.219
116.128.13.184
202.173.8.214
203.135.160.36
220.154.213.131
119.253.101.234
202.38.192.131